Q. What are the additional/different challenges for Kubernetes storage at the edge – in contrast to the data center?  

A. Edge means different things depending on context. It could mean enterprise or provider edge locations, which are typically characterized by smaller, compact deployments of Kubernetes. It could mean Kubernetes deployed on a single node at a site with little or no IT support, or even disconnected from the internet, on ships, oil rigs, or even in space for example. It can also mean device edge, like MicroShift running on a small form factor computer or within an ARM or FPGA card for example.

Business Resiliency in a Kubernetes World

At the 2018 KubeCon keynote, Monzo Bank explained the potential risk of running a single massive Kubernetes cluster. A minor conflict between etcd and Java led to an outage during one of their busiest business days, prompting questions, like “If a cluster goes down can our business keep functioning?”  Understanding the business continuity implications of multiple Kubernetes clusters is an important topic and key area of debate.
